ABSTRACT

This work is concerned with road traffic offence information management in Nigeria. It focused on trends in road traffic offences information and carried out a critical review of current information and communication and technology compliance state of FRSC with a view to identifying its defects in road traffic offence information management. A system to correct road traffic offence information management failure as identified in the existing system was then proposed. Road traffic offence records and details of current safety measures obtained from FRSC and online in addition to research works, provided the basic data for the study. The system was designed using the object OOAD methodology and implemented using rapid Php IDE on a Windows 7 system, using PHP, HTML,CSS and mySQL technologies and Apache server as the application server. The result showed the high rate of road traffic offence as a result of poor road traffic offence information management and failure to improve on the existing road traffic information management.

1.1     Background of Study

Nigeria
ranked as the country with the second largest road network in Africa in 2011.It
population density which varies in rural and urban areas (approximately 51.1%
and 48.3% respectively) translates to a population-road ratio of 860 persons
per square kilometres showing intense traffic pressure on the available road
network [1].This pressure contributes to the high road traffic offence mishap
in the country. In Nigeria, road transport is the most commonly used by the
majority of citizen, as the easiest option in moving goods and travellers.
Despite the important role played by road transport, the sector has encountered
a number of challenges emanating from poor road traffic offences information
management, resulting to incessant road accidents. Road accidents, resulting
from careless driving, over-speeding and other road traffic offences have
resulted to numerous consequences including deaths, injuries, disabilities and
loss of properties, all of which accelerate to poverty in the country. The
death of the most productive member exerts a devastating impact to the
families, pushing many into poverty with long lasting effect to their children
and their community at large [2].
The poor road offence information management
situation in Nigeria has reached such an alarming proportion even to the point
of sheer frustration and near helplessness. While many developing and developed
countries have made concerted efforts to reduce road traffic offence through
the adoption of improved management information technology, Nigeria seems to be
lagging behind.  

Global trends in road transportation have shown that efficient and safe transportation management models are becoming highly dependent on Information and Communications Technologies[3].There is need for technological interventions in reducing road offences and its consequences, road accidents. Road safety is a global concern not only for public health and injury prevention but also to improve efficiency in road traffic management[3].ICTs’ adoption in road traffic offence information management operations will help to achieve the ambition of drastic reduction in road traffic offences and road accidents prevalent in Nigeria.

  1. Statement of Problem

The
way and manner motorists use the roads leave much to be desired. Vehicle
drivers take delight in driving on wrong lanes and even abuse the right of way
rules, thereby creating conflict in the use of traffic, course delay and
sometimes accident. This has lead to enormous road traffic offence on our roads
particularly in the cities. This is attributable to poor road traffic offence
management. Improved computerized Management Information Systems is the
fundamental and the bedrock for increase in Information Technology (IT).
Because of the importance of the improved information technology (IT), measures
are taken to evolve all sectors of the economy into improved Information
Technology compliant. The road traffic offence information sector should not be
left out, because an increase in the use of improved information management
technology has greater advantages, where process of collecting, processing, storage, retrieval and dissemination
of road traffic offence information for the purposes of planning, controlling,
coordinating and decision making are not in tone with times. The existing
system of road traffic offence gives no room for pictorial identification of
offenders. Hence wrong person could be accused. The system is decentralized
making road traffic offence information manipulation and accessibility of the
database difficult. Also the system has no room for pictorial diagram display
of the offence committed, as well as the penalty of offence as an evidence to
facilitate prosecution. Hence the offender often sees himself as being
compelled to accept responsibility.

  1. Objective of Study

As Nigerian road safety agency, FRSC management embraces the use
of computers and information technologies in transport infrastructure. As the
development and implementation of improved technological systems continue, it
is believed that intelligent transport system will provide an increase in
capacity, management and productivity of traditional transport infrastructure
as well as contribution to achieving of other goals such as improved management
in road traffic offence.

This study seeks to design a system that can achieve the following
objectives:

  • Centralised road
    traffic offence information databanks where road traffic offence information
    can be easily accessed by all authorised user.
  • Reduce error in
    offenders’ identification, as lots offenders escape offence due to wrong
    identification (pictorial identification) during and after documentation which
    makes prosecution of offenders’ difficulty.
  • Displays a pictorial
    sketch or diagram of an offence committed as clear evidence to offenders’
    crime. This can also be tendered in court during prosecution.

Road
traffic Information Management System provides road traffic information that is
needed to manage road traffic organizations efficiently and effectively. Road
traffic information management and the information it generates are generally
considered essential components of prudent and reasonable business decisions.
With the growth in information technology, the study offers numerous benefits
to the Federal Road Safety Commission and other organisations that deal with
road traffic offence information management. There are many reasons why a
research on the road traffic offence information management system should be
made at this time. The chief reasons being that:

  • Road traffic offence
    information management system uses integrated database-stores all road traffic
    offence information in a single database. This enhances fast, timely and
    secured accessibility and sharing of road traffic offence reports for the
    agency’s decision making
  • Identifying road
    traffic offenders with their pictorial images will aid the agency in authentic
    documentation and avoid prosecuting wrong persons.
  • Often times, Offenders
    deny ever committing a crime they are apprehended for due to absence of diagram
    sketch/pictorial display showing the crime committed. Displaying offender crime
    for the offender to see enhance the agency’s credibility and makes FRSC road
    traffic information reports reliable.

Road Traffic Offence

This
phrase refers to any act that causes or liable to cause violation of road traffic
rules and regulations. Road traffic offence is an action taken or action not
taken that violates road safety rules and regulation. For instance not
reporting a road traffic accident is a road traffic offence.

 Information Technology

This
term also called information system refers to a set of interrelated components
that work together to collect, retrieve, process, store and disseminate
information for the purpose of facilitating planning, control, co-ordinating
and decision making. It usually includes hardware, software, people, communication
systems, and data [4].

Information and
Communication Technology

This
refers to the fusion of Telecommunications, Electronics and
Computer Information Systems used to retrieve, analyze, store, process,
transmit, secure and intelligently interpret digital data either in storage or
in transit [5]

Intelligent
Transport Systems

This refers to wide area of information based on wireless technology combined into infrastructure of transport system and the vehicle itself, these systems help in controlling and managing of traffic flows, reducing of traffic, finding alternative routes, saving of the environment as well as saving time [6].
